How Long Do Acid Reflux Medications Take to Work?

Acid reflux affects millions of people across the UK, causing uncomfortable symptoms like heartburn and regurgitation. Understanding how quickly different treatments work can help you manage expectations and choose the most appropriate medication. Proton pump inhibitors like omeprazole typically provide symptom relief within 1-3 days, though full effectiveness may take up to two weeks. The timing varies depending on the type of medication, severity of symptoms, and individual response to treatment.

  • Proton pump inhibitors (PPIs) like omeprazole usually begin working within 1-3 days
  • H2 receptor blockers such as famotidine may provide relief within 30-60 minutes
  • Maximum effectiveness of PPIs typically occurs after 1-2 weeks of regular use
  • Lifestyle modifications work gradually over several weeks to months

Understanding Different Acid Reflux Treatment Timelines

Proton Pump Inhibitors (PPIs) - The Gold Standard

Proton pump inhibitors represent the most effective class of medications for treating acid reflux and GERD. Omeprazole 20mg capsules, available through EverydayMeds, typically begin providing symptom relief within 1-3 days of starting treatment. However, patients should understand that maximum benefit may not be achieved until after 1-2 weeks of consistent daily dosing. This delayed onset occurs because PPIs work by gradually reducing stomach acid production rather than neutralising existing acid.

How PPIs Work in Your System

When you take omeprazole or other PPIs like lansoprazole 15mg capsules, the medication needs time to accumulate in your system and bind to acid-producing cells in the stomach lining. This process explains why some patients may not experience immediate relief. The medication effectively switches off acid pumps, but existing acid must first clear from your system. Clinical studies show that approximately 70% of patients experience significant symptom improvement within the first week of PPI therapy.

Alternative Treatment Options and Their Timelines

H2 receptor blockers like famotidine tablets, also available through EverydayMeds, work differently than PPIs and may provide faster initial relief. These medications can begin reducing acid production within 30-60 minutes of taking them. However, their overall effectiveness for severe acid reflux is generally less than PPIs. Famotidine may be particularly useful for breakthrough symptoms or night-time reflux when taken alongside PPI therapy.

Factors Affecting Treatment Response Time

Several factors influence how quickly acid reflux medications work. Severe oesophageal inflammation may require longer healing times, potentially extending symptom relief to 4-8 weeks. The timing of medication administration also matters - PPIs work best when taken 30-60 minutes before breakfast on an empty stomach. Food intake, other medications, and individual metabolism can all affect absorption and effectiveness of treatments like pantoprazole 20mg tablets or esomeprazole.

Optimising Your Treatment Approach

For optimal results, consistency in taking prescribed medications is crucial. Missing doses can delay symptom improvement and allow acid production to return. Some patients may require dose adjustments or combination therapy with different medication classes. Lifestyle modifications, including dietary changes and weight management, work synergistically with medications but typically require several weeks to months to show significant impact on symptom frequency and severity.
